The Benefits of Probiotics for Vaginal Health

Vaginal health is a crucial aspect of women’s overall well-being. It plays a vital role in maintaining the balance of good and bad bacteria in the vagina, which is essential for preventing infections and maintaining a healthy environment. Probiotics have become increasingly popular in recent years, and their benefits for vaginal health have been the subject of much research and discussion.

What are Probiotics?

Probiotics are live microorganisms, mostly bacteria, that are similar to the beneficial bacteria found in the human gut. They are often referred to as “good bacteria” because they help to maintain a healthy balance of bacteria in the body, particularly in the gut and vagina. Probiotics are available in many forms, including supplements, yogurt, and fermented foods.

How Probiotics Benefit Vaginal Health

Prevent Yeast Infections

  1. One of the most common vaginal infections is yeast infections, which occur when the balance of good and bad bacteria in the vagina is disrupted. Probiotics can help prevent yeast infections by maintaining the balance of bacteria and keeping yeast in check.

Reduce Bacterial Vaginosis (BV) Risk

  1. Bacterial vaginosis is a common vaginal infection that occurs when there is an overgrowth of bad bacteria in the vagina. Probiotics have been shown to reduce the risk of BV by helping to maintain a healthy balance of bacteria in the vagina.

Improve Overall Vaginal Health

  1. Probiotics can also help to improve overall vaginal health by boosting the immune system and reducing inflammation. They can also help to prevent vaginal dryness and discomfort, which can be caused by hormonal changes or menopause.

Promote a Healthy Pregnancy

  1. Probiotics are also beneficial for pregnant women, as they can help to prevent infections, such as yeast infections and BV, that can harm the baby. They can also help to support a healthy pregnancy by reducing inflammation and supporting the immune system.

Probiotics are beneficial for vaginal health, as they help to maintain a healthy balance of bacteria in the vagina, prevent infections, and improve overall vaginal health. Whether through supplements, yogurt, or fermented foods, incorporating probiotics into your daily routine can have significant benefits for your vaginal health. However, it’s important to speak with your healthcare provider before starting any new supplement or health regimen.
